Abstract
In order to find an effective arithmetic which can suppress the useless reflected wave of the ionosphere, a new model for the reflected wave of the ionosphere is proposed here. Using the multiple phase-screen method used for the investigation of the HF wave propagation, the amplitude scintillation and phase scintillation of the reflected wave of the ionosphere can be achieved. Using the results of the multiple phase-screen method and considering the altitudinal change of the reflect-point, a model for the reflected wave of the ionosphere is given. Then, the experimentally derived data of the reflected wave of the ionosphere are analyzed. The statistical results of the real date prove the validity of the model for the reflected wave of the ionosphere.
